Transaction 3e93998393293dbb71f67f807dd17f032ac82c07c488d2af00622dc4fe3e2106

1 Input
2 Outputs
  • 3e93998393293dbb71f67f807dd17f032ac82c07c488d2af00622dc4fe3e2106:0
  • value  250961
    address  35b69eKvTPRRZMryMAFswNRvLkG6YCNExC
  • 3e93998393293dbb71f67f807dd17f032ac82c07c488d2af00622dc4fe3e2106:1
  • value  437683570
    address  bc1qfppc5p7tjgyxdf9ztf3jev0nedkewpglh8pggk4acwhu9ucnw5qqt3vzhl